I recreated a trap using a trunk tree that is probably a week or so
old.  I couldn't reproduce with
java all setup and running, but if I went into my preferences, disabled
java, closed the browser and then opened the browser to recreate it, I
got the trap.  Could someone else who also gets the trap verify if they
are getting an assertion of "no placeholder frame" in their output to
make sure that I am seeing the same problem?

My trap info:

Trapping in GetNearestContainingBlock because of a bad first parameter.
Bad parameter coming from nsHTMLReflowState::InitAbsoluteConstraints.
This function is calling presShell->GetPlaceholderFrameFor which is
coming back w/o a placeholderFrame.

Seems to be happening during the reflow of the middle canvas with the
scroll bars.
